Transaction 72d61b96b2ab57a25bcceec68903b1327ee1dc99cec2322730dbca31b7f12868
1 Input
2 Outputs
- 72d61b96b2ab57a25bcceec68903b1327ee1dc99cec2322730dbca31b7f12868:0
- 72d61b96b2ab57a25bcceec68903b1327ee1dc99cec2322730dbca31b7f12868:1
value 19478369
address 12jHbYWxiDxXi5ub3GsyjRez5fpYEwysAf
value 1903297534
address 1GKkseEN2CEzVp19RZnWESftC4iSiZ1CcS